dc.description.abstract | In recent decades the technology, in constant development, has made efforts to put out several devices that contribute to improve the quality of life for the people, among them are the personal virtual assistants that were developed to help organize and perform a large number of tasks of the everyday rush. In recent years there has been a growth in the development of personal virtual assistants controlled by voice, mainly in modern smartphones, as a result of technological advances and research in the integration and combination of techniques such as voice recognition, natural language processing and the use of artificial intelligence. Examples of voice-activated virtual assistants that are already part of everyday life are: Siri® from Apple, Cortana® from Microsoft, and Google Assistant® from Google. The developed prototype uses systems ready for the voice / text interface and the AIML language for the processing of natural language. This prototype should give basic personal assistance commanded by voice to the user in a residential scope. | |
